Jan 20, 2022 · Additional to investing own capital into the real estate deal, the sponsor takes on a heavy-lifting role to boost returns for passive investors and gets compensated for this by sponsor promote. Sponsor promote is the amount of profit that a sponsor receives above what he would typically earn according to his contributed capital to the deal ... The type of beauty pageant dictates the variety of sponsorship, with smaller pageants having a higher degree of local business participation.Summary of Deals Sponsorship Fees. The acquisition fee is the most prevalently used for real estate deal sponsors, commonly around 1.5% but can vary between 1% and 2%, depending on the size of the deal. Typically, the bigger the deal, the smaller the rate. To effectively attract sponsors, it is essential for nonprofits to have well-designed and compelling charity sponsor for...A real estate sponsor is an individual or organization responsible for overseeing all aspects of a commercial real estate investment. This includes identifying potential investment opportunities, conducting due diligence on those properties, underwriting the deals, crafting a business plan, arranging financing (both debt and equity), and then ...
